Web1 sep. 2001 · Ever since hydralazine, edema has been a well-documented adverse effect of vasodilators. Pathogenesis of vasodilatory edema (VDE) is related to at least three mechanisms which include the following: Arteriolar vasodilation increases intracapillary pressure, thereby exuding fluid into the interstitium. Web28 nov. 2024 · Hydroxyzine is an antihistamine that’s prescribed for allergies, itching, and anxiety.There are two forms of hydroxyzine: hydroxyzine hydrochloride and hydroxyzine pamoate (Vistaril). Both forms work the same way in the body to help treat symptoms. This means they also have similar risks, including drug interactions..
